/* * Copyright 2003,2004 The Apache Software Foundation. *  * Licensed under the Apache License, Version 2.0 (the "License"); * you may not use this file except in compliance with the License. * You may obtain a copy of the License at *  *      http://www.apache.org/licenses/LICENSE-2.0 *  * Unless required by applicable law or agreed to in writing, software * distributed under the License is distributed on an "AS IS" BASIS, * WITHOUT WARRANTIES OR CONDITIONS OF ANY KIND, either express or implied. * See the License for the specific language governing permissions and * limitations under the License. */package com.sun.org.apache.xerces.internal.xs;/** *  Represents an abstract PSVI item for an element or an attribute  * information item. */public interface ItemPSVI {    /**     * Validity value indicating that validation has either not been performed      * or that a strict assessment of validity could not be performed.      */    public static final short VALIDITY_NOTKNOWN         = 0;    /**     *  Validity value indicating that validation has been strictly assessed      * and the item in question is invalid according to the rules of schema      * validation.      */    public static final short VALIDITY_INVALID          = 1;    /**     *  Validation status indicating that schema validation has been performed      * and the item in question is valid according to the rules of schema      * validation.      */    public static final short VALIDITY_VALID            = 2;    /**     *  Validation status indicating that schema validation has been performed      * and the item in question has specifically been skipped.      */    public static final short VALIDATION_NONE           = 0;    /**     * Validation status indicating that schema validation has been performed      * on the item in question under the rules of lax validation.      */    public static final short VALIDATION_PARTIAL        = 1;    /**     *  Validation status indicating that full schema validation has been      * performed on the item.      */    public static final short VALIDATION_FULL           = 2;    /**     *  The nearest ancestor element information item with a      * <code>[schema information]</code> property (or this element item      * itself if it has such a property). For more information refer to      * element validation context and attribute validation context .      */    public String getValidationContext();    /**     *  <code>[validity]</code>: determines the validity of the schema item      * with respect to the validation being attempted. The value will be one      * of the constants: <code>VALIDITY_NOTKNOWN</code>,      * <code>VALIDITY_INVALID</code> or <code>VALIDITY_VALID</code>.      */    public short getValidity();    /**     *  <code>[validation attempted]</code>: determines the extent to which      * the schema item has been validated. The value will be one of the      * constants: <code>VALIDATION_NONE</code>,      * <code>VALIDATION_PARTIAL</code> or <code>VALIDATION_FULL</code>.      */    public short getValidationAttempted();    /**     *  <code>[schema error code]</code>: a list of error codes generated from      * the validation attempt or an empty <code>StringList</code> if no      * errors occurred during the validation attempt.      */    public StringList getErrorCodes();    /**     * <code>[schema normalized value]</code>: the normalized value of this      * item after validation.      */    public String getSchemaNormalizedValue();    /**     * <code>[schema normalized value]</code>: Binding specific actual value      * or <code>null</code> if the value is in error.      * @exception XSException     *   NOT_SUPPORTED_ERR: Raised if the implementation does not support this      *   method.     */    public Object getActualNormalizedValue()                                   throws XSException;    /**     * The actual value built-in datatype, e.g.      * <code>STRING_DT, SHORT_DT</code>. If the type definition of this      * value is a list type definition, this method returns      * <code>LIST_DT</code>. If the type definition of this value is a list      * type definition whose item type is a union type definition, this      * method returns <code>LISTOFUNION_DT</code>. To query the actual value      * of the list or list of union type definitions use      * <code>itemValueTypes</code>. If the <code>actualNormalizedValue</code>     *  is <code>null</code>, this method returns <code>UNAVAILABLE_DT</code>     * .      * @exception XSException     *   NOT_SUPPORTED_ERR: Raised if the implementation does not support this      *   method.     */    public short getActualNormalizedValueType()                                   throws XSException;    /**     * In the case the actual value represents a list, i.e. the      * <code>actualNormalizedValueType</code> is <code>LIST_DT</code>, the      * returned array consists of one type kind which represents the itemType     * . For example:      * <pre> &lt;simpleType name="listtype"&gt; &lt;list      * itemType="positiveInteger"/&gt; &lt;/simpleType&gt; &lt;element      * name="list" type="listtype"/&gt; ... &lt;list&gt;1 2 3&lt;/list&gt; </pre>     *       * The <code>schemaNormalizedValue</code> value is "1 2 3", the      * <code>actualNormalizedValueType</code> value is <code>LIST_DT</code>,      * and the <code>itemValueTypes</code> is an array of size 1 with the      * value <code>POSITIVEINTEGER_DT</code>.      * <br> If the actual value represents a list type definition whose item      * type is a union type definition, i.e. <code>LISTOFUNION_DT</code>,      * for each actual value in the list the array contains the      * corresponding memberType kind. For example:      * <pre> &lt;simpleType      * name='union_type' memberTypes="integer string"/&gt; &lt;simpleType      * name='listOfUnion'&gt; &lt;list itemType='union_type'/&gt;      * &lt;/simpleType&gt; &lt;element name="list" type="listOfUnion"/&gt;      * ... &lt;list&gt;1 2 foo&lt;/list&gt; </pre>     *  The      * <code>schemaNormalizedValue</code> value is "1 2 foo", the      * <code>actualNormalizedValueType</code> is <code>LISTOFUNION_DT</code>     * , and the <code>itemValueTypes</code> is an array of size 3 with the      * following values: <code>INTEGER_DT, INTEGER_DT, STRING_DT</code>.      * @exception XSException     *   NOT_SUPPORTED_ERR: Raised if the implementation does not support this      *   method.     */    public ShortList getItemValueTypes()                                   throws XSException;    /**     *  <code>[type definition]</code>: an item isomorphic to the type      * definition used to validate the schema item.      */    public XSTypeDefinition getTypeDefinition();    /**     * <code>[member type definition]</code>: if and only if that type      * definition is a simple type definition with {variety} union, or a      * complex type definition whose {content type} is a simple type      * definition with {variety} union, then an item isomorphic to that      * member of the union's {member type definitions} which actually      * validated the schema item's normalized value.      */    public XSSimpleTypeDefinition getMemberTypeDefinition();    /**     * <code>[schema default]</code>: the canonical lexical representation of      * the declaration's {value constraint} value. For more information      * refer to element schema default and attribute schema default.      */    public String getSchemaDefault();    /**     * <code>[schema specified]</code>: if true, the value was specified in      * the schema. If false, the value comes from the infoset. For more      * information refer to element specified and attribute specified.      */    public boolean getIsSchemaSpecified();}
